#811546 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#811546 is composed of 50.6% red, 8.2%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.7% magenta, 45.7%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 332.8 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 29.4%. #811546 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a8c with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#811546 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#811546 has RGB values of R:129, G:21,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.46,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8459590.

Shades and Tints of #811546
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0206 is the darkest color, while #fef9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#811546
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d494b is the less saturated color, while #920444 is the most saturated one.
